EU is reportedly considering removing Russian sanctions against oil trader Niels Troost, FT reports

Context

The EU's consideration to lift sanctions against oil trader Niels Troost could signal a potential softening in its stance towards Russia, which may have implications for energy markets and geopolitical tensions. This decision could also influence currency dynamics, particularly the euro and USD, as market participants assess the broader ramifications of easing sanctions on energy supplies. Watch for volatility in oil prices and associated commodities as this develops.
